单眼剥夺树鼩外侧膝状核中Y细胞的丧失。

Loss of Y-cells in the lateral geniculate nucleus of monocularly deprived tree shrews.

作者信息

Norton T T, Casagrande V A, Sherman S M

出版信息

Science. 1977 Aug 19;197(4305):784-6. doi: 10.1126/science.887922.

DOI:10.1126/science.887922
PMID:887922
Abstract

In tree shrews (Tupaia glis) reared with one eye closed, Y-cells were almost entirely absent in the binocular segment of the lateral geniculate laminae receiving input from the deprived eye. Y-cells were found in the monocular segment of these laminae, and in the binocular segment of the laminae with input from the normal eye. X-cells were present in both the deprived and normal laminae and appeared unaffected by the deprivation. A number of abnormal cells were also found, and these were located primarily in the binocular segment where Y-cells were absent.

摘要

在单眼闭合饲养的树鼩(笔尾树鼩)中,外侧膝状体板层接受来自被剥夺眼输入的双眼段几乎完全没有Y细胞。在这些板层的单眼段以及接受来自正常眼输入的板层双眼段中发现了Y细胞。X细胞在被剥夺和正常的板层中均存在,且似乎不受剥夺的影响。还发现了一些异常细胞,这些细胞主要位于没有Y细胞的双眼段。
